Top 5 Volcano Trekking Holidays for Adventurers in 2025

Volcano trekking holidays offer the perfect mix of adventure and natural beauty. We’ve rounded up the top 5 volcano treks from around the world, each offering unforgettable views, thrilling challenges and unique experiences. Whether you're exploring Indonesia's fiery giants or Iceland’s rugged terrain, these trips are sure to blow your mind!

Guatemala's volcanoes at sunset

If you're a seasoned trekker seeking big climbs and big views, Guatemala’s Magnificent Seven will push your limits. This epic journey conquers seven volcanoes, including the region’s highest.

Highlights:

  • Summit Central America's tallest volcano: Tajumulco (4,220m) delivers unmatched sunrise panoramas.

  • Camp near Fuego and witness its glowing eruptions light up the night sky.

  • Serenity: Rest and recharge by one of the world’s most beautiful lakes: Lake Atitlán

Why go? A true test of endurance and spirit; this trip rewards you with volcano-top sunrises and deep cultural experiences.

Masaya Volcano at sunset

A kaleidoscope of landscapes and biodiversity awaits in Nicaragua. This laid-back trekking holiday balances light hikes with wildlife encounters and tranquil moments.

Highlights:

  • Hike the steaming slopes of Mombacho and Cerro Negro and visit Masaya’s fiery crater at sunset.

  • Canoe through the Indio Maíz Biosphere Reserve, home to jaguars and tropical birds.

  • Explore Ometepe Island and hike to the San Ramon Waterfall.

  • Roam the colonial streets of Granada and the artistic haven of León.

Why go? This is the perfect pick for those who want a balance of nature, volcanoes, wildlife, history and the right amount of trekking to leave you energised and rewarded with unforgettable views.

Mount Bromo, Java

Indonesia is home to more active volcanoes than any other country, making it the ultimate destination for volcanic adventure. This immersive trek takes you across Java, Bali and Lombok, summiting five awe-inspiring peaks.

Highlights:

  • Conquer Merbabu, Bromo, Kawah Ijen, Batur and the towering Mt Rinjani (3,726m) for unforgettable views.

  • Enjoy an overnight wild camp on Mt. Rinjani at sunset before trekking to the summit for sunrise.

  • Explore the ancient Borobudur temple and rice terraces of Ubud.

  • Unwind on Sanur’s palm-fringed beaches after days of high-altitude trekking.

Why go? This trekking holiday offers the perfect blend of activity, adventure, culture and relaxation!

Sunsets over El Salvador

El Salvador may be small, but it packs a powerful punch when it comes to volcanic trekking. With eight volcanic ascents, cloud forests and colonial charm, this journey is a vibrant, lesser-known adventure.

Highlights:

  • Trek El Salvador's highest peaks: Santa Ana (2,381m) and El Pital (2,730m), with views reaching Honduras.

  • Soak in Santa Teresa’s thermal waters and unwind at the Pacific beaches of El Cuco.

  • Cruise to Isla Zacatillo for sun-drenched relaxation in the Gulf of Fonseca.

  • Discover colourful towns like Suchitoto and verdant coffee plantations.

Why go? This itinerary is unique to KE and perfect for adventurers looking for an off-the-beaten-path trek packed with volcanic summits and cultural charm.

Crossing the Fjallaback - credit: Jan Zelina

Iceland’s iconic Laugavegur Trail delivers a compact adventure full of lava fields, glaciers, waterfalls and rainbow-coloured rhyolite mountains as you trek across the Fjallabak from Landmannalaugar to Thorsmork.

Highlights:

  • Trek across steaming valleys, obsidian lava fields and icy river crossings.

  • Hike the Fimmvorduhals Pass and see the lava stream that flowed down from the volcano in 2010 plus the two craters, Magni and Modi,

  • Stay in cosy mountain huts. Recharge with hearty Icelandic meals and warm hut hospitality.

Why go? For a surreal, geologically rich adventure through one of the most dramatic volcanic landscapes on Earth.
